Learn Pest

This repo contains some example Pest tests from Pest. I find it easier to "play" with the examples to see how they work. Writing passing tests help me to better understand the assertions. The following chapters have been created:

Installation

This project only has Pest as a dev dependency. The installation is similar to most PHP projects.

Requirements

Recommended:

Clone or Download this Project from GitHub

See Cloning a repository for details on how to create a local copy of this project on your computer.

For example:

git clone [email protected]:Pen-y-Fan/learn-pest.git

Install the Dependencies

The project uses Pest PHP, the tests has been written using PHP 8+ named parameters. Composer is highly recommended installing the dependencies.

From the root of the project run composer install from the command line:

cd learn-pest
composer install

Testing

Run all the tests

composer test
